Sp. Attack goes up 10%, Defense goes down. Mild is a pick for Pokemon that mix physical and special attacks but lean toward the special side. Over in Diamond & Pearl, Drifloon, Venusaur, Vaporeon, and others all run Mild in competitive play. The competitive scene in Diamond & Pearl is mature. Mild is standard on any Pokemon that benefits from Sp. Attack.
Mild raises Sp. Attack by 10% and lowers Defense by 10%. Special attackers willing to sacrifice physical bulk. 26 Pokemon competitively run this nature.

How to Get
SynchronizeLead with a Mild Pokemon that has the Synchronize ability. Wild Pokemon will match its nature. (Gen 3+)
BreedingGive the parent with Mild nature an Everstone. The offspring will inherit it. (100% since Gen 5)
Nature MintUse a Mild Mint to change stat effects to Mild. The original nature name stays but stats change. (Gen 8+)

What does the Mild nature do in Pokemon?
It's a +10% Sp. Attack, -10% Defense nature. The 10% multiplier applies after base stats and EVs, so the actual point difference grows as stats get higher. Pokemon with Mild nature prefer Dry flavor and dislike Sour.

How do I get a Mild nature Pokemon?
Three options: (1) Synchronize lead forces wild Pokemon to match your lead's nature. (2) Everstone breeding passes the nature 100% of the time since Gen 5. (3) a Mild Mint changes the stat effects after the fact. Mints don't change the nature name, just the stat modifiers.
Should I use Mild or Modest?
It depends on what your team needs. Mild is the mixed offense option. Modest is the dedicated special option. Most of the time, your Pokemon's moveset and role make the decision obvious.
